The co-owners of one of the hottest restaurants in New York, The Meatball Shop, are experts in meatballs, but Daniel Holzman and Michael Chernow, stars of CNBC's docu-series Consumed, are turning their attention to another meat: the spiral-cut hot dog.

"This is the trend for 2015!" Holzman says, demonstrating how to take a skewer through the dog and wind up with a spiral that can hold the condiments inside.
